i dunno, i cant really decide whether it would be good or bad...
here's how i break it down: good (for legalization): - increases tax money, government needs it - reduces number of drug dealers- less business for them - less underrage smokers- kids who want to smoke are more likely to just wait until they can legally, and less people will become addicted early - its not very hard to get now, so why not control it - by going into the business, the government might have an easier time tracking illegal drug sales bad (against legalization) - more people experiment, more people get addicted - might eventually lead to legalization of all drugs, or a more relaxed attitude towards them - people might still buy illegal weed of the legal price is too high - secondhand smoke could reach dangerous levels if people could walk around in public smoking weed |
